Abstract

A beamsplitter includes an optical substrate with a first surface configured to receive a beam of multi-spectral light, to reflect a first band of the multi-spectral light and to transmit a second band of the multi-spectral light through the optical substrate to be emitted from a second surface of the optical substrate opposite the first surface. The second surface is a freeform surface. A system includes a telescope configured to focus multi-spectral light into a beam. The system also includes a beamsplitter as described above optically coupled to the telescope so the first surface of the beamsplitter is configured to receive the beam of multi-spectral light from the telescope.
